Understanding 48V Lithium Battery Cut-Off Voltage: Key Factors and Recommendations

In the realm of renewable energy and energy storage solutions, 48V lithium batteries have emerged as a popular choice. One of the crucial aspects of battery management that often raises questions among users is the cut-off voltage. Understanding this concept is vital for ensuring the longevity and performance of your battery system. In this blog post, we will delve into what cut-off voltage is, its significance, and how it applies specifically to 48V lithium batteries.

What is Cut-Off Voltage?

Cut-off voltage is defined as the voltage level at which a battery will cease to discharge. This threshold is integrated into the battery's management system to prevent the cells from discharging below a certain level. For lithium batteries, including the 48V configuration, maintaining the correct cut-off voltage is essential to avoid damage and prolong the life of the cells.

Why is Cut-Off Voltage Important?

The importance of cut-off voltage cannot be overstated. Discharging a lithium battery below its cut-off voltage can lead to several detrimental effects:

  • Cell Damage: Most lithium-ion cells are designed to operate within specific voltage ranges. Allowing the voltage to drop below these levels can result in irreversible damage, leading to reduced capacity and failure of the cells.
  • Safety Risks: Batteries that are over-discharged can pose safety hazards such as thermal runaway, which can result in fires or explosions. Proper cut-off settings can mitigate these risks effectively.
  • Performance Degradation: Regularly discharging a battery below its designated cut-off voltage can result in degraded performance. Users may experience reduced runtime and efficiency.

Identifying the Cut-Off Voltage for 48V Lithium Batteries

The cut-off voltage for a 48V lithium battery system is typically calculated based on the number of cells connected in series, as each cell has a nominal voltage of approximately 3.2V to 3.7V. A standard 48V lithium battery system commonly consists of 13 cells in series, resulting in a nominal voltage of 51.8V (13 x 3.7V).

For general applications, a safe cut-off voltage for 48V lithium batteries can range from 40V to 44V. This range ensures that the cells do not dip into dangerously low voltage levels. Setting the cut-off voltage too high can lead to underutilization of the available capacity, while setting it too low can risk damaging the battery.

Factors Influencing Cut-Off Voltage

Several factors should be considered when determining the ideal cut-off voltage for a 48V lithium battery:

  • Battery Chemistry: Different lithium battery chemistries (e.g., LiFePO4, NMC) have different voltage characteristics. Understanding these can help in setting the right cut-off.
  • Application: The specific use case—whether for electric vehicles, solar storage, or other applications—can influence cut-off settings. Some may require more or less available capacity.
  • Temperature: Ambient temperature affects battery performance and lifespan. Variations in temperature can alter the ideal cut-off voltage.
  • Charge Cycle History: The battery's discharge history can affect its current capacity. A battery that has been consistently cycled may require adjustment in cut-off settings.

Best Practices for Setting Cut-Off Voltage

To ensure optimal performance and longevity of 48V lithium batteries, certain best practices should be adhered to when it comes to cut-off voltage:

  1. Manufacturer Recommendations: Always refer to the manufacturer's guidelines for specific voltage settings for your battery model.
  2. Utilize Battery Management Systems (BMS): A good BMS is designed to automatically cut off the discharge at preset voltage limits, protecting the battery effectively.
  3. Regular Monitoring: Implement a monitoring system to keep track of battery voltage levels and performance. It can help in adjusting the cut-off voltage if needed.
  4. Environmental Considerations: Factor in the operating environment and adjust settings based on ambient temperatures and other variables.

Common Misconceptions About Cut-Off Voltage

Several myths surround the concept of cut-off voltage, leading to confusion among users. Here are a few common misconceptions clarified:

  • Myth 1: “Batteries can be fully discharged without consequences.” This is false; over-discharging can severely damage the battery.
  • Myth 2: “The cut-off voltage is the same for all batteries.” This varies based on battery chemistry and application, as noted earlier.
  • Myth 3: “Cut-off voltage is not adjustable.” While some systems may have fixed cut-off settings, many modern systems allow for user adjustments based on specific needs.
